WebDec 12, 2024 · The state of Florida has different title fees you need to know, such as: New vehicles: $77.25 (electronic title) Vehicles previously registered in Florida: $75.25 (electronic title) Out-of-state vehicles: $77.25. Adding a lien to a vehicle title: $74.25. Printed paper title additional fee: $2.50. WebOct 23, 2024 · In Florida, tags must be surrendered to a Florida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) or a tax collectors office location before you can get an insurance policy in another state. Failure to do so could result in a suspension of your Florida driver’s license and a fine up to $150 plus tax. list of s \u0026 p 500 stocks

WebWhether the car was owned only by the deceased person, was jointly owned, or if the car is part of a probated estate, the Executor will need the following documents: An order from Probate Court allowing for the vehicle transfer. The Certificate of the Title. The Death Certificate for the former owner. An Odometer Disclosure Statement. WebSection 320.0609(1)(a), Florida Statutes, requires that the registration, license plate and certificate of registration shall be issued to and remain in the name of the owner of the vehicle registered. However, a personalized license plate may be transferred to a vehicle owned or co-owned by the plate owner. See RS-27 for more information.
